Kentucky Christian University vs. Pennsylvania College of Art and Design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Kentucky Christian University or Pennsylvania College of Art and Design?

  • Pennsylvania College of Art and Design is 20.1% more expensive to attend than Kentucky Christian University for in-state tuition ($27,750.00 vs. $23,100.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 20.1% higher at Pennsylvania College of Art and Design than Kentucky Christian University ($27,750.00 vs. $23,100.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Kentucky Christian University than Pennsylvania College of Art and Design ($22,682 vs. $26,649)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Kentucky Christian University are 29.9% lower than costs at Pennsylvania College of Art and Design ($8,980 vs. $11,665)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at Kentucky Christian University as Pennsylvania College of Art and Design (100% vs. 100%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Kentucky Christian University students is 10.4% larger than aid received Pennsylvania College of Art and Design ($14,398 vs. $13,038)

Kentucky Christian University vs. Pennsylvania College of Art and Design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Kentucky Christian University or Pennsylvania College of Art and Design?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Pennsylvania College of Art and Design and Kentucky Christian University.

  • The graduation rate at Pennsylvania College of Art and Design is higher than Kentucky Christian University (52% vs. 44%)
  • Graduates from Kentucky Christian University earn on average $4,900 more per year than Pennsylvania College of Art and Design graduates after ten years. ($33,600 vs. $28,700)
  • Kentucky Christian University students graduate with a $1,250 lower median federal student loan debt than Pennsylvania College of Art and Design graduates. ($25,750 vs. $27,000)
  • Kentucky Christian University graduates are paying $13 less per month on federal student loans than Pennsylvania College of Art and Design graduates. ($266 vs. $279)
  • More Pennsylvania College of Art and Design gra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Kentucky Christian University students, three years after graduation. (58% vs. 56%)
